a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Rasmus Fuhse <fuhse@data-quest.de>2026-01-28 12:42:23 +0000
committerJan-Hendrik Willms <tleilax+studip@gmail.com>2026-01-29 16:53:21 +0100
commite5c14685e11dcb9ca73f028835af3e9639758401 (patch)
treeac3bb8a07c5e3a273b048118275259c5e52a6e8c
parentfdeec3f4a6f1ac38e37ae410779517fe5daddb1a (diff)
Resolve "Warning in der CoreWiki Navigation"
Closes #6203 Merge request studip/studip!4695
-rw-r--r--lib/modules/CoreWiki.class.php3
1 files changed, 2 insertions, 1 deletions
diff --git a/lib/modules/CoreWiki.class.php b/lib/modules/CoreWiki.class.php
index f188319..485dad6 100644
--- a/lib/modules/CoreWiki.class.php
+++ b/lib/modules/CoreWiki.class.php
@@ -116,8 +116,9 @@ class CoreWiki extends CorePlugin implements StudipModule
$navigation->setActiveImage(Icon::create('wiki', Icon::ROLE_INFO));
$id = RangeConfig::get($range_id)->WIKI_STARTPAGE_ID;
+ $startpage = $id ? WikiPage::find($id) : false;
- $title = $id ? htmlReady(WikiPage::find($id)->name) : _('Wiki-Startseite');
+ $title = $startpage ? htmlReady($startpage->name) : _('Wiki-Startseite');
$navigation->addSubNavigation('start', new Navigation($title, 'dispatch.php/course/wiki/page'));
if (WikiPage::countBySQL('`range_id` = ?', [$range_id]) > 0) {
if ($GLOBALS['perm']->have_studip_perm('user', $range_id)) {